全网最全在线文本对比工具(支持代码/符号/段落全字符比对)
原文文本(左侧)
对比文本(右侧)
比对结果(删除标红、新增标绿)
1.核心功能介绍
在线文本对比工具是一款全字符级别的diff比对系统,支持中文汉字、英文字母、数字、标点符号、特殊符号、换行空格、编程代码、JSON、HTML、脚本、长段落文案、合同文本、软文内容等全部字符识别比对,不会遗漏任意微小符号差异。
2.操作步骤
- 左侧输入原始文本内容,系统实时自动统计左侧全部字符数量;
- 右侧输入需要对标、修改后的新版本文本,实时统计右侧字符;
- 点击【一键对比差异】,系统逐字符遍历两段内容,标记两处不匹配内容;
- 红色底色为原文独有/删除内容,绿色底色为新版本新增/修改内容;
- 支持切换白天/夜间护眼模式,夜间模式优化文字对比度,解决字体模糊看不清问题;
- 电脑、笔记本、平板、手机移动端全部自适应布局,无需放大缩小。
3.适用场景
- 程序员代码版本比对、HTML/JS/CSS源码差异检测
- 文案编辑、自媒体软文新旧稿件查重区分不同段落
- 合同、协议、标书文字修改痕迹快速识别
- 小说、文章、论文两段内容逐字核对
- 带特殊符号、公式、乱码文本精准比对
- 批量文案、网站内容、SEO文章差异校验
配套关联工具:一发惊人首页提供全套在线文本处理工具,包含字符统计、文本去重、代码格式化、在线查重等辅助功能。
1.字符统计计算公式
总字符数 = 汉字数量 + 英文字母数量 + 数字数量 + 标点符号 + 特殊符号 + 空格字符 + 换行转义字符
统计逻辑:读取文本全部原始字符串长度 String.length,不剔除任何隐藏字符,做到100%精准计数。
2.最长公共子序列LCS比对核心公式
本工具采用LCS最长公共子序列算法实现逐字符差异匹配,核心逻辑:
设原文数组A长度M,对比文本数组B长度N
定义二维匹配矩阵 dp[M+1][N+1]
若 A[i-1] == B[j-1],dp[i][j] = dp[i-1][j-1] + 1
若字符不相等,dp[i][j] = max(dp[i-1][j], dp[i][j-1])
通过回溯匹配矩阵,分离出删除字符(红色标记)、新增字符(绿色标记)、完全匹配字符(无底色)。
3.差异差值计算
字符差值 = 右侧总字符数 - 左侧总字符数;正数代表新增内容更多,负数代表删减内容更多。
算法优势:区别于普通全文查重工具,文本字符对比工具支持单符号、单空格、单换行微小差异识别,不会忽略空白字符、不可见特殊符号。
1.什么是Diff文本差异比对?
Diff是计算机领域通用文本差异检测技术,最早用于代码版本管理工具Git、SVN,能够对比两份文本文件逐字符区别,区分删除、新增、修改内容。传统diff工具仅适配代码,本工具优化兼容中文、全角符号、中文标点、复杂混合文本,面向普通办公、文案、自媒体用户免费使用。
2.全角/半角符号比对区别
工具严格区分全角逗号,,与半角逗号,、全角空格 与半角空格 ,二者字符编码不同,会判定为差异并高亮标注,避免文案、代码因符号格式错误出现线上故障。
3.隐藏特殊符号识别范围
支持识别制表符\t、换行符\n、回车符\r、不可见零宽空格、emoji表情、数学公式符号、拉丁特殊字母、中文生僻字、异体字等所有Unicode字符。市面上多数简易对比工具会过滤隐藏字符,造成比对结果失真,本工具保留全部原始字符。
4.字符统计行业标准
自媒体、文案行业常用字符统计分为两种:含符号总字符、纯文字不含标点统计,本工具默认展示全量字符(含所有符号空格),满足标书、论文、平台字数限制校验需求。如需纯文字统计可前往一发惊人首页字符统计工具。
5.前端AMP页面适配技术科普
本页面采用AMP加速移动页面标准开发,页面加载速度比普通HTML提升70%,移动端无卡顿、无延迟,原生CSS无外部样式、原生JavaScript无jQuery第三方依赖,符合搜索引擎移动端优化规范,访问更流畅稳定。
Q1:为什么两段肉眼看起来一样的文字会显示差异?
A:存在隐藏特殊符号、全半角空格、换行、零宽字符、emoji、标点符号格式不同,工具逐Unicode编码比对,肉眼无法分辨的微小字符都会标记,适合严谨校对场景。
Q2:夜间模式文字模糊看不清怎么解决?
A:本代码已优化夜间模式配色,深色背景搭配浅海蓝色高对比度文字,结果区域红绿标记增加透明度缓冲,不存在字体模糊bug;若屏幕亮度过低可调高设备亮度。
Q3:能否对比上万字超长段落、完整代码文件?
A:支持本地前端运算,无后端上传限制,十万字内文本均可流畅比对,所有计算在浏览器本地完成,不会上传文本到服务器,内容隐私安全。
Q4:对比结果能否复制导出?
A:结果框支持全选复制,复制后保留文字,颜色标记会移除,如需带标记截图保存即可。
Q5:手机端页面排版错乱怎么办?
A:页面采用AMP响应式网格布局,自动适配手机竖屏、横屏、平板、宽屏显示器,清理浏览器缓存重新刷新即可恢复正常。
Q6:工具是否永久免费使用?
A:在线文本对比工具完全免费无次数限制,无需登录、无广告弹窗,所有功能开放使用。
Q7:支持哪些编程语言代码比对?
A:HTML、CSS、JavaScript、PHP、Python、Java、JSON、SQL、Shell脚本等全部纯文本格式代码均可精准比对字符差异。
1.轻量化前端本地运算成主流
近几年在线文本工具趋势从后端服务器比对转向浏览器本地JS运算,无需上传用户文本,保护隐私,加载速度更快,本款字符差异对比工具紧跟行业趋势,全部逻辑本地执行,无数据上传接口。
2.全字符兼容需求持续提升
自媒体、程序员、法务标书校对需求上涨,用户不再只对比普通中文,对特殊符号、代码、隐藏字符精准识别需求增加,简易查重工具逐步淘汰,全能型逐字符对比工具成为刚需。
3.多终端自适应+昼夜护眼标配
移动端办公普及,用户长时间校对文字,昼夜双模式、平板手机电脑自适应已经成为专业在线文本工具基础配置,本页面内置切换开关,自动保存用户模式偏好。
4.AMP加速页面优化是SEO核心方向
搜索引擎优先收录AMP标准移动端页面,加载速度、体验评分更高,大量工具站开始重构AMP规范页面,本站全部工具页面均采用原生AMP开发,提升移动端搜索排名与用户访问体验。
5.多功能一体化工具平台发展
单一功能工具逐步整合,一站式文本处理平台成为趋势,一发惊人首页整合文本对比、字符统计、代码格式化、文本去重、在线翻译、查重检测等全套工具,满足用户一站式办公需求。